Flow cytometric DNA analysis of oral squamous cell carcinoma in Iraqi patients
B T Garib1, S Al-Ani, N Al-Alwan
1Department of Oral Pathology, College of Dentistry, University of Baghdad, Baghdad, Iraq.
Abstract:
We studied the DNA content, DNA index and cell cycle parameters that are reliable markers for assessing the proliferative activity and aggressiveness of malignancies. Cytometric DNA analysis was performed on formalin-fixed paraffin embedded sections from 36 Iraqi patients with oral squamous cell carcinoma. The results showed that 20 of 36 cases (55.5%) were diploid, while 15 cases (41.7%) were aneuploid. Significantly higher S-phase fractions and higher DNA indices characterized aneuploid tumours. Nuclear DNA analysis as part of the evaluation of oral squamous cell carcinoma will influence the selection of appropriate treatment strategies.
